Liberty holds annual signing ceremony
Liberty held its annual press conference for senior student-athletes heading to college this fall on April 21, as 32 Hurricanes were represented in this year’s class.
The signing ceremony has been a yearly event at Liberty, highlighting the core of Liberty’s top athletes heading to the next level.
Football standout Jaohne Duggan made his decision to commit to Rutgers last summer and he’s never looked back on his decision after enjoying a stellar senior campaign, which saw him land on first-team East Penn Conference honors at defensive end, as well as first-team All-State.
“I’m just excited to get down there,” said Duggan about heading to Rutgers. “I might start heading down for workouts at the end of May. I can’t wait to play college football. I know they’ll probably move me around a little bit between defensive tackle and defensive end my freshman year, but I hope I can get a good amount of playing time.”
Duggan is one of two Hurricanes to commit to FBS (Football Bowl Subdivision) schools, as wide receiver Darian Street is heading to the University of Pittsburgh.
He’ll have some company there, as defending state champion track sprinter Jaylyn Aminu will become a Pitt Panther as well.
“I felt very home when I went there and the coaches had a set plan on what they wanted from me,” said Aminu about ultimately choosing Pitt. “I have some other friends that are going to Pitt too, which is why it’ll feel like home too.”
Aminu is a three-time state medalist in the 100 meter and won the 3A state title last season. She’s been nursing a heel and tibia injury this season so far, but is resting up for a postseason run to another hopeful gold medal.
